Building blocks of Client or Server
Describe the building blocks of Client or Server.
Expert
The client side building block executes the client side of application. The server side building block executes the server side of application.
The middleware building block executes on both client and server sides of an application. This is broken into three groups:
• Transport stack• Network OS• Service-specific middleware
